[QUOTE="guywhofishes, post: 312529, member: 337"] I have had both the fatty and the tall 11s... the skinny is better if you have a way to support/transport. The fatty is a horrible space hog - and the handle/knob seem to reach out and screw other stuff up. Wish they made tanks that didn't have sharp metal edges all over the place. [IMG]https://i.ebayimg.com/images/g/m~wAAOSwzStdVslL/s-l640.jpg[/IMG] wait... whaaaaaaat??? [COLOR="silver"][SIZE=1]- - - Updated - - -[/SIZE][/COLOR] [COLOR=#000000][FONT=Arial]11-lb Propane Tank made of fiberglass composite materials. 50% lighter than steel propane cylinders, but just as durable. These tanks stack easily, are corrosion free, and are encased in a plastic housing with handle for easy transportation. Outer walls of tank are translucent so you can see exactly how much propane is left. The wide stable base helps this tank to not tip over.
